Jack Up brings back the good times this summer

Centred around feel-good music from the ’80s and ’90s, there’ll be guaranteed fun for all the family at Jack Up The Summer next weekend (August 6-8). The fantastic feel-good festival will feature live music from the likes of Heaven 17, Heather Small, From The Jam, Black Lace and Aswad, as well as Queen and Abba tribute groups. There’ll be locally-produced food and drink plus the world’s only inflatable circus including a 100ft ‘Fun House’ inflatable assault course for kids and adults who think they’re kids.

Having postponed last year’s event due to the pandemic, organisers have been working around the clock ever since to give Islanders something uplifting to look forward to this year. Event organiser, Sarah Moss, said: “As a completely independent, home-grown Island event, our ethos has always been to invest in local services and skills whilst giving back to charities and good causes. With the event being a real labour of love for our small team, there was never any doubt that we owed it to our loyal audiences, traders, charities and artists to forge ahead positively.

“Our amazing suppliers, artists, traders and all involved with the festival cannot wait to get together to stage an event that will be safe, welcoming and, most importantly, a place to make happy memories once again.”
